Location: Deer Path Park is located in Readington Township on West Woodschurch Road. The park is open from 8:00 AM to sunset. Directions from the Flemington Area: Take Route 31 north about 4 miles from the Flemington Circle. Turn right onto West Woodschurch Road, following the signs for Deer Path Park and the YMCA. Proceed about 0.7 miles on West Woodschurch Road to the entrance to the park on the right. The YMCA's entrance is the immediate right off of the driveway. Continue pass the YMCA entrance. The parking lot for the soccer fields will be visible on the left-hand side of the driveway. The main parking lot for the park is located at the end of the driveway near the rest rooms. Directions from the Clinton Area: Take Route 31 south about 6.5 miles from Interstate 78. Use the jughandle for West Woodschurch Road to cross over Route 31. Follow the signs for Deer Path Park and the YMCA. Then follow the corresponding directions above {TO TOP}

Deer Path Pond is a 3 acre spring fed pond which offers wide open banks. Anglers can fish for a variety of species which include bass, catfish and sunfish. The pond is designated for catch and release and State Fish and Wildlife rules apply. {TO TOP}
Deer Path offers walk-in picnic sites with grills at Locust Grove and Hideaway. The Cedars and Overlook Pavilions are reservable by obtaining a facility use permit at the Park Office, or download one from our site.

MEMORIAL GAZEBO AND GARDEN Named in remembrance of Alois and Berta Batz, this gazebo and small garden offers a place of color and tranquility along the pond. The gazebo can be reserved for activities such as wedding photos. {TO TOP}
There are two soccer fields and a softball field that can be reserved independently or in conjunction with a pavilion. The soccer fields were constructed by the Hunterdon United Soccer Club and serve as their home fields. {TO TOP}
Special events and performances are offered at Deer Path Park at various times throughout the year. The most notable is our Summer Concert Series. Other events have included performance camp, community festivals and scout events. Contact the main office for the latest schedule of community events. {TO TOP}
